If the zoom knob on a dissecting scope is set to 1.2 what is the total magnification of objects viewed of objects viewed through
TEA [102]

Total magnification of objects is 12x.

Dissecting microscopes are microscopes with only one set of lenses so they have less magnification than a compound microscope.

The eyepiece, or ocular lens of microscope, usually has a magnification of 10x. The numbers on magnification knob range from about 0.7 to 3. So, when you want to calculate the total magnification multiply the magnification on the eyepiece with the number on the magnification knob.

What percent of the moon is covered by dark areas?
Gwar [14]

Answer:

Those spots are called maria, from the Latin word for sea, because early astronomers mistakenly thought they were lunar seas (they're actually volcanic plains). The smooth and dark maria cover 17 percent of the surface of the moon. Almost all of them are visible from Earth
